容器
Docker学习与和应用(二)_使用Docker
在前一篇文章 Docker学习与和应用(一)_初步认识中,我们初步介绍了Docker解决了什么问题,Docker容器化技术与传统的虚拟化方式的区别,以及简要介绍了Docker的几大核心概念:镜像、容器和仓库。本文主要介绍Docker的使用,包括:使用Docker管理镜像、容器和仓库使用Dockerfile创建自定义镜像容器的数据管理Docker的安装和基础命令Docker是
业界
2016年06月26日
Docker的八种用途
Docker 提供轻量的虚拟化,你能够从Docker获得一个额外抽象层,你能够在单台机器上运行多个Docker微容器,而每个微容器里都有一个微服务或独立应用,例如你可以将Tomcat运行在一个Docker,而MySQL运行在另外一个Docker,两者可以运行在同一个服务器,或多个服务器上。未来可能每个应用都要Docker化。容器的启动和关系是非常快速的。Docker目前能够
业界
2016年06月29日
程序员必读之软件架构-笔记
架构的驱动力(影响最终软件架构的重要事情)包括下面这些:功能需求:需求驱动架构。不管怎么捕捉和记录需求(比如,用户故事、用例、需求规格书、验收测试等),你都要大概知道你在构建什么。质量属性:非功能需求(比如,性能、可扩展性、安全等)通常是技术方面的,也很难改造。理论上,这些都需要体现在初始的设计中,忽视这些属性会导致软件系统要么做得不够,要么做得太过。约束:约束普遍存在于现
业界
2016年07月04日
容器监控—阿里云&容器内部服务监控
目前Docker的使用越来越离不开对容器的监控,阿里云最近上线了容器服务,不但提供了核心的容器和宿主机监控能力,而且支持集成 Cloud Insight 监控,下面会介绍如何集成。首先介绍一下阿里云的容器监控。阿里云容器服务在用户创建集群的时候就默认开启了几个容器服务,其中就包括一个容器监控服务,其监控大概就是使用这个服务来采集数据的。容器监控的对象就是各个正在跑的容器本身
业界
2016年07月05日
Kubernetes方法论之扫盲篇
随着容器逐渐受到企业的注意,焦点慢慢被转移到了容器编排工具上。复杂的工作负载在生产过程中需要成熟地被调度,编排,弹性扩容和管理工具。有了Docker,管理运行在主机操作系统上的容器以及它的生命周期变得十分容易了。因为容器化的工作负载运行在多个主机上,我们需要一些工具在上面管理单个的容器和单个的主机。Docker数据中心,也就是Mesosphere DC/OS和Kuberne
业界
2016年07月06日
Kubernetes方法论:扩容和可靠性
在第一篇文章里,我们探索了在Kubernetes中pods和services的概念。现在,我们来理解一下如何用RC来完成弹性扩容以及可靠性。我们也会讨论一下如何将持久化带入布置在Kubernetes上的云本地应用程序。RC:弹性扩容和管理微服务如果pods是一个单元,部署和services是抽象层,那么谁来追踪pods的健康状况呢?于是RC就这样出场了。在pods被部署之后
业界
2016年07月06日
docker命令易错点整理
pausedocker pause可以暂时停止容器,以释放一部分CPU出来给其他服务使用docker unpause可以解冻docker stop vs killstop会首先尝试正常结束容器(发送SIGTERM信号给容器中的程序),如果程序没有响应的话,则强制结束容器(发送SIGKILL信号);kill则会直接强制结束容器参数简写-d--detach,即后台运行-i--i
业界
2016年07月06日
稳定高于一切的金融行业如何用容器?
复杂的基础IT架构是传统金融的现状,如何快速响应用户需求,加快新业务上线速度,缩短产品的迭代周期? 数人云在容器落地金融云的2年实践中,实现金融核心业务技术WebLogic、J2EE、Oracle中间件的容器生产标准,已在证券交易所、股份制银行落地生根发芽。服务编排、服务发现、持续集成、大数据容器化、高性能容器环境等多方面为业界提供参考实施标准,真正构建动态灵活的金融IT。
业界
2016年07月06日
代码级干货 | 如何利用Docker与Rails API gem构建微服务
今天小数给大家带来的是一篇代码级干货文章,与大家分享一些利用Rails API以微服务形式设置应用的经验与心得。为何选择Docker加Rails API?在我效力的企业中,我们一直在利用Docker为全部工程师构建开发环境。在这种情况下,新人加入后能够快速拥有与之对应的容器工作环境。与大多数长久使用整体应用的企业一样,我们同样希望充分发挥微服务架构带来的松散耦合、高紧凑性与
业界
2016年07月06日
